Steven Anderson, a multifaceted individual, entered this world on November 24, 1955, in the vibrant city of Los Angeles, California, USA. With a dual career spanning both in front of and behind the camera, Anderson has made a lasting impact in the entertainment industry.
His impressive repertoire includes notable appearances in television series such as The X-Files, which premiered in 1993 and captivated audiences worldwide, as well as the 1979 horror classic When a Stranger Calls. Moreover, his talents have also been showcased in the iconic science fiction franchise Star Trek: The Next Generation, which debuted in 1987 and has since become a beloved staple of popular culture.
